Crawlspace foundation repair services involve diagnosing and addressing issues within the space beneath a building's first floor. This area, often hidden from view, can develop problems such as moisture intrusion, mold growth, or structural damage over time. Repair work may include installing vapor barriers, repairing or replacing damaged joists and beams, and sealing gaps to prevent pests and water from entering. Properly maintaining the crawlspace can help improve the overall stability of the property and prevent further deterioration.
Many common problems that lead property owners to seek crawlspace repair include uneven flooring, persistent musty odors, or visible signs of water intrusion. These issues often stem from inadequate drainage, poor ventilation, or foundation settlement. Addressing these concerns through professional repair services can help mitigate risks associated with wood rot, mold growth, and structural instability. Timely intervention can also reduce long-term repair costs and safeguard the property's value.
Properties that typically utilize crawlspace foundation repair services include single-family homes, small commercial buildings, and older structures with accessible crawlspaces. Homes built on pier and beam foundations are especially likely to require ongoing maintenance or repairs to ensure the foundation remains stable and dry. Additionally, properties in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high humidity may benefit from regular inspections and repairs to prevent moisture-related problems.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Miamitown,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ost of Crawlspace Foundation Repair - Typical expenses range from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the extent of the damage and repair methods used. For example, minor repairs may cost around $1,500, while extensive foundation stabilization can exceed $5,000.
Factors Influencing Costs - Prices vary based on the size of the crawlspace, severity of issues, and local labor rates. Larger or more complex projects in Miamitown, OH, generally fall toward the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Average Price Range - Most homeowners spend between $2,000 and $4,000 for foundation repair services. This includes inspections, repairs, and any necessary reinforcement or leveling work.
Additional Expenses - Costs may increase if extensive underpinning, moisture barriers, or structural reinforcements are required.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ific crawlspace con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
